Output 434e6474abae76363d0873c73ac73163c0139dbd4063151d90c98c033b27e10d:0

value
136600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e329e181b29848fb5dd07ff1996f5663a484e59 OP_EQUAL
address
35uHeLX7UsH6u7Ae838TCEtSsV1F5sTd2s
transaction
434e6474abae76363d0873c73ac73163c0139dbd4063151d90c98c033b27e10d
confirmations
306860
spent
true